This is an extremly simple case for the geeetech prusa i3 acrylic series. Build of lack tables from IKEA and other mostly cheap materials. For me it was about ~45 €, without the filaments costs. But the amount of filament used is only about 200g.
### Extra needs:
* 2 IKEA Lack tables
* 8 Magnets 5mm x 2mm (like https://www.conrad.de/de/permanent-magnet-rund-n45-137-t-grenztemperatur-max-80-c-conrad-components-505865.html)
* 4 Planes of plexiglas 500mm x 500mm x 2mm ( like https://www.bauhaus.info/aluplatten-kunststoffplatten/plexiglas-glatt-xt-/p/20114024
* IKEA Ledberg LED lamp
* Tiny pieces of PCB and wire for the ledberg connector
~40 screws 3.5 x 20 or similar.
### Tools needed:
* Drill 14mm
* Forstner drill 28mm
* Soldering stuff
#### The plexiglass mounting
You need to print the lack_magnet_holder **8 times**, with a resolution of at least 0.1mm and 35% and up infill
